Staffing Rating

When examining the Staffing Rating for The Reutlinger Community, which stands at 3.0, we see that this facility performs slightly below the state average by 3%, but notably exceeds the national benchmark by 11%. Staffing is a crucial factor in evaluating nursing homes, as it directly impacts the quality of care provided to residents. Higher staffing levels often correlate with better patient outcomes, as residents receive more personalized attention and assistance with their daily needs. While a rating of 3.0 suggests room for improvement in staffing levels at The Reutlinger Community compared to the state average, the facility's performance surpassing the national average indicates a dedication to maintaining a higher standard of care. In terms of Total nursing staff turnover, The Reutlinger Community reports a turnover rate of 49.1%, which is 7% higher than the state average but 7% lower than the national average. Staff turnover is a critical metric in assessing nursing homes, as high turnover rates can indicate potential issues such as staff dissatisfaction, burnout, or inadequate staffing levels. A lower turnover rate is generally preferred, as it suggests a more stable workforce and potentially higher staff morale. While The Reutlinger Community's turnover rate is slightly elevated compared to the state average, it is noteworthy that the facility fares better than the national average in this aspect. This indicates that despite the higher turnover rate locally, the facility is still able to retain staff better than many other facilities across the country.
